3分钟学会AI智能图像分层免费开源工具让复杂插画秒变PSD图层【免费下载链接】layerdividerA tool to divide a single illustration into a layered structure.项目地址: https://gitcode.com/gh_mirrors/la/layerdivider还在为提取插画中的单个元素而烦恼吗layerdivider正是你需要的AI智能图像分层工具这个开源项目利用先进的颜色聚类算法能将任何单张图像自动转换为层次分明的PSD图层结构。无论你是设计师、插画师还是游戏美术师layerdivider都能将原本需要数小时的手动分层工作缩短到几分钟内完成。 什么是layerdividerlayerdivider是一个基于Python开发的智能图像处理工具专门用于将单张插图自动分解为可编辑的PSD图层。通过智能的颜色识别和边界检测技术它能自动分离图像中的不同颜色区域生成可直接在Photoshop中编辑的分层文件。核心优势极速处理几分钟完成数小时的手工工作智能分层基于颜色聚类算法精准识别不同区域完全免费开源项目无任何使用限制高度可定制提供丰富的参数调节选项 快速上手3步开启智能分层第一步环境安装1分钟如果你是Windows用户安装过程非常简单git clone https://gitcode.com/gh_mirrors/la/layerdivider cd layerdivider .\install.ps1对于其他操作系统或者想要更灵活的控制可以使用Python安装python install.py安装过程会自动配置所有必要的依赖包包括图像处理库和PSD文件生成模块。第二步启动图形界面30秒安装完成后启动layerdivider的图形界面# Windows用户 .\run_gui.ps1 # 其他系统 python scripts/main.py启动后系统会自动打开浏览器显示一个简洁直观的用户界面。界面包含文件上传区域和各种参数调节滑块设计友好即使没有技术背景也能轻松上手。第三步体验AI分层1.5分钟现在让我们快速体验layerdivider的强大功能上传图像点击界面中的上传按钮选择一张你想要处理的插图使用默认参数保持所有参数为默认值点击Create PSD按钮查看结果几秒钟后你会看到处理完成的图层预览下载PSD点击下载按钮获取完整的PSD文件处理效果对比处理阶段传统手动方式layerdivider智能方式时间消耗数小时几分钟图层精度依赖人工技能算法保证一致性可重复性难以完全一致每次结果完全相同学习成本需要专业技能简单易学 核心功能详解智能颜色聚类算法layerdivider的核心技术基于CIEDE2000颜色相似度标准这是目前最精确的颜色差异计算方法之一。这意味着工具能够精准识别颜色差异即使颜色非常接近也能准确区分保持视觉完整性分层后的图像与原图视觉效果一致自适应调整根据图像复杂度自动优化聚类数量双模式输出系统layerdivider提供两种输出模式适应不同的工作场景普通模式生成基础颜色图层结构简洁适合快速提取元素和简单分层需求。复合模式包含效果图层和混合模式结构完整适合专业设计和需要保留原有效果的场景。智能参数调节工具内置了智能参数推荐系统同时提供丰富的自定义选项参数功能说明推荐值适用场景loops迭代次数影响分层精度3-5次精细分层需求init_cluster初始聚类数量决定分层数量8-12个控制图层数量ciede_threshold颜色相似度阈值控制合并敏感度5-10调整颜色合并程度blur_size模糊处理大小影响边缘平滑度3-5像素优化边缘效果 实际应用场景场景一游戏美术资源制作需求游戏开发中需要将角色立绘拆分为不同部位用于动画制作或换装系统。解决方案将角色立绘导入layerdivider调整init_cluster参数至15-20获得更精细的分层使用composite模式生成包含效果图层的完整PSD导出后直接在游戏引擎中使用优化技巧对于游戏角色建议设置loops6以获得更精细的边缘处理。场景二UI设计元素提取需求从设计稿中提取可复用的UI组件构建设计系统。工作流程预处理确保输入图像分辨率适中建议2000-4000像素宽参数调整设置较低的ciede_threshold值3-5以保持颜色准确性输出模式使用normal模式输出基础图层后处理在Figma或Sketch中进行进一步优化场景三插画分层与再创作需求艺术家想要将完成的插画分层进行不同风格的再创作。高级技巧色彩丰富图像增加loops值6-8以获得更精细的分层背景分离使用split_bg选项自动分离背景图层透明度处理调整alpha参数控制透明度的处理阈值 技术架构解析layerdivider采用模块化设计核心功能分布在不同的Python模块中核心处理模块ldivider/ld_processor.py- 包含主要的图像分层算法格式转换模块ldivider/ld_convertor.py- 处理PSD文件生成和格式转换工具函数模块ldivider/ld_utils.py- 提供各种辅助函数和工具主脚本文件scripts/main.py- 图形界面的后端逻辑处理流程图像加载读取输入图像转换为标准格式颜色聚类基于RGB信息进行智能颜色分组边界检测识别颜色区域之间的边界图层生成为每个颜色区域创建独立图层PSD导出将所有图层打包为PSD文件⚡ 性能优化建议处理速度优化图像尺寸处理前适当调整图像大小建议宽度不超过4000像素参数精简非必要参数保持默认值硬件利用确保有足够的内存和CPU资源输出质量优化边缘处理适当调整blur_size参数值越大边缘越平滑颜色精度根据需求调整ciede_threshold值越小颜色区分越精细图层数量通过init_cluster控制分层数量值越大图层越多❓ 常见问题解答Q: 处理后的图像边缘有锯齿怎么办A: 调整blur_size参数可以优化边缘处理效果。建议从3开始尝试根据效果调整到5-10之间。Q: 如何控制生成图层的数量A: 通过init_cluster参数可以控制初始聚类数量这直接影响最终生成的图层数量。值越大图层越多分层越精细。Q: 支持哪些图像格式A: layerdivider支持常见的图像格式包括PNG、JPG、JPEG等。建议使用PNG格式以保持透明度信息。Q: 处理大图像时内存不足怎么办A: 可以尝试以下方法在处理前减小图像尺寸调整init_cluster参数减少图层数量关闭其他占用内存的应用程序Q: 生成的PSD文件能在哪些软件中打开A: 生成的PSD文件兼容Adobe Photoshop、GIMP等主流图像编辑软件确保图层结构和混合模式正确保留。️ 高级使用技巧批量处理自动化通过修改脚本中的处理逻辑可以实现文件夹级别的批量处理# 批量处理示例代码 import os from ldivider.ld_utils import divide_folder input_folder path/to/input/images output_folder path/to/output/psds # 处理整个文件夹 for image_file in os.listdir(input_folder): if image_file.endswith((.png, .jpg, .jpeg)): # 调用分层处理函数 process_single_image(os.path.join(input_folder, image_file))与其他设计工具集成与Photoshop工作流集成使用layerdivider生成基础分层在Photoshop中进一步优化图层使用智能对象和调整图层增强效果导出为所需格式与Figma/Sketch集成导出分层后的PSD文件在Figma/Sketch中导入并转换为矢量元素构建设计系统组件库 参数配置指南快速配置模板根据不同需求可以参考以下配置模板快速分层模板适合简单图像quick_params { loops: 3, init_cluster: 8, ciede_threshold: 8, blur_size: 3, layer_mode: normal }精细分层模板适合复杂插画detailed_params { loops: 6, init_cluster: 15, ciede_threshold: 5, blur_size: 4, layer_mode: composite }游戏资源模板适合角色立绘game_params { loops: 6, init_cluster: 18, ciede_threshold: 7, blur_size: 4, layer_mode: composite } 进阶学习路径初学者路径运行demo.py了解基本功能通过图形界面体验分层效果尝试调整基本参数观察效果变化中级用户路径学习核心参数的作用和调优方法尝试批量处理功能与其他设计工具集成使用高级用户路径研究ldivider/ld_processor.py中的算法实现根据需要修改或扩展功能贡献代码或文档到项目 最佳实践总结预处理建议图像准备确保输入图像分辨率适中建议2000-4000像素宽格式选择使用PNG格式保持透明度信息颜色模式建议使用RGB模式以获得最佳效果处理流程优化参数测试先用小尺寸图像测试参数设置批量处理将相似类型的图像放在一起处理结果验证检查生成的PSD图层命名和组织结构后处理技巧图层整理在Photoshop中合并相似图层简化结构命名规范建立统一的图层命名规则模板创建将成功的参数设置保存为模板 开始你的AI图像分层之旅layerdivider不仅仅是一个工具它是一个重新定义图像处理工作流程的解决方案。通过智能化的颜色聚类算法它将繁琐的手动分层工作转化为一键完成的自动化流程。无论你是专业设计师需要快速提取设计元素还是游戏美术师需要处理角色资源亦或是插画师想要对作品进行二次创作layerdivider都能为你节省大量时间让你专注于更有价值的创意工作。现在就开始体验AI智能图像分层的魅力吧开启你的智能分层之旅释放创意潜能立即开始git clone https://gitcode.com/gh_mirrors/la/layerdivider cd layerdivider python install.py python scripts/main.py让layerdivider成为你创意工作流程中的得力助手体验智能分层带来的高效与便捷【免费下载链接】layerdividerA tool to divide a single illustration into a layered structure.项目地址: https://gitcode.com/gh_mirrors/la/layerdivider创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考